How to Write for People and Algorithms?

Category descriptions are primarily intend! to affect sales, as well as the position of your store in organic Google searches. The best practice seems to be to write them in accordance with SEO rules . However, you cannot forget that descriptions are also aim! at the user. They are to provide them with information, arouse the desire to own, and also facilitate navigation around the site.

Therefore, when optimizing your descriptions, you ne! to consider a few practices and principles that will help you with this:

  • plan the keywords you will use in the content – ​​be guid! by the number of searches and place the most important phrases at the top of the text, assign specific phrases to each paragraph and do not duplicate them;
  • do not overload the text with keywords – a short description of the SEO category with a huge number of key words will not look good and will not be comfortable to read, try to place phrases, e.g. every 1500-2000 characters;
  • use synonyms – don’t stick to one phrase that doesn’t sound the best even in its inflection, stay completely natural and use synonyms that users also enter into the search engine;
  • you do not artificially increase the length of the text – in fact, a long category description gives a greater chance of including keywords in it, but it will not always position the website better and will not always encourage the user to read;
  • use distinguishing features that will diversify the text for the user and algorithms – headings, bullet points, bold and underline should be includ! in the category description, as they influence the reception of the text by both parties.
